Understanding the Role of Collateral in Costa Rica Development Loans
Exploring financing avenues in Costa Rica can open doors to lucrative opportunities. One critical aspect of securing a loan is understanding the role of collateral. A certified appraisal is essential to determine the value of property and its suitability as collateral.
The Registro Nacional is the official body responsible for verifying property titles and liens. This legal review is crucial to ensure that the property is free from any encumbrances. Additionally, mortgage registration typically incurs a fee of about 1.64% of the total mortgage amount.
Legal agreements must be formalized through public deeds before a Notary Public. This step ensures enforceability under local law. Understanding local tax obligations, such as the 0.25% annual property tax, is also vital for maintaining financial stability.
- Ensure the property is free from liens or boundary conflicts.
- Work with professionals for thorough property appraisals.
- Verify that all municipal taxes and construction permits are current.
- Conduct a rigorous review of the title and registry status.

Risk Management, Due Diligence, and Exit Strategies
To thrive in Costa Rica’s real estate market, effective risk management and due diligence are key. Investors must evaluate the developer’s track record to understand potential risks. A thorough assessment helps lenders gauge the project’s viability and expected returns.
Implementing draw management and phased funding controls is essential. This approach ensures that capital is released only as construction milestones are achieved. Such practices safeguard the investment and enhance the project’s success rate.
Moreover, having a clear exit strategy is vital. This could involve selling the property or refinancing with a long-term institutional lender. Each loan we coordinate includes this strategy to maintain financial stability.

In Costa Rica’s evolving market, innovative financing options are reshaping how buyers approach property investments. Understanding the differences between private lending and traditional bank financing is essential for investors.
Traditional banks often require a verifiable credit history, which can slow down the process for foreign investors. In contrast, private lenders assess each borrower’s unique situation, offering tailored financing solutions. This flexibility allows investors to act quickly in a competitive market.
Many buyers leverage the equity of their home country properties or use self-directed IRAs to invest in Costa Rica. The strong rental market here enables property owners to cover their monthly costs through vacation rentals, making real estate an attractive option.
